Creating the right amount of water at the right time to produce exceptional crop and business outcomes is one of the most complex tasks in agriculture.chongqing lumo technology Yet, too many growers still aren’t irrigating as effectively as they would like. The reason is that traditional solutions are expensive, complicated, slow to install, and difficult to maintain.

Lumo’s all-in-one precision irrigation system is designed to change that.chongqing lumo technology Its patented hardware, intuitive software, and local field team provide growers with an end-to-end solution that’s simple to install and easy to use. The result is better crops and more sustainable business outcomes.

In addition to its LCM chip, the company has developed a full suite of software tools that help farmers optimize and automate their irrigation systems. Its flagship product, Lumo Field Manager, enables growers to monitor and adjust their watering schedules and receive alerts when soil conditions are changing. This helps them save time, reduce operating costs, and ensure their crops are getting the water they need to thrive.
